Uncharted Adaptation Again Lost a Director

Despite the many failures, adapting video games to the big screen is still a profitable opportunity for production houses. Of course in the future there will be many line-ups of adaptations that will slide, and one of the most anticipated is the Uncharted film adaptation.

However, it can be said that the Uncharted film adaptation is one of the projects that has many obstacles to realize. Starting from the script that is often overhauled to the loss of the director many times, it always becomes an obstacle to the progress of the film. Unfortunately again, the misfortune did not stop there, this time the film project lost its director – Travis Knight.

Travis Knight has left the film adaptation of Uncharted.

The reason the Bumblebee film director left the Uncharted adaptation was due to deadlines. With the departure of Travis Knight, there are now a total of six directors who have not handled the film adaptation, five others are Dan Trachtenberg, Shawn Levy, Seth Gorden, Neil Burger, and David O. Russel.

Of course, this is unpleasant news, considering Uncharted is one of the most anticipated franchises for its big screen adaptation.
